Tableau is the dominant business intelligence and data visualisation platform, used by millions of analysts globally. Its AI features, integrated through Salesforce Einstein, bring generative AI, natural language interaction, and automated insight discovery to business intelligence workflows where most time is spent building and interpreting charts.
Tableau Pulse, a major AI feature, automatically monitors KPIs and sends personalised AI-generated insight summaries to stakeholders who don't build their own dashboards — explaining what changed in the metrics, why it may have changed, and what to pay attention to. This brings data insights to a broader audience than those who actively log into Tableau.
Asked natural language questions about data, Tableau's Q&A and Einstein Copilot features generate visualisations from questions like 'show me sales by region for Q3 compared to Q2' without requiring manual chart building. This makes exploratory data analysis faster for analysts and accessible to business users who cannot build charts themselves.
Explain Data analyses any data point on a chart and generates AI explanations of why that value is anomalous — identifying the factors in the data that drove the outlier. For analysts who see unexpected values and need to understand the underlying cause without digging through raw data, this AI explanation capability is directly actionable.
At $75/user/month for Creator with AI features included, Tableau represents a significant investment but remains the established standard for enterprise BI.

Tableau Creator $75/user/month. Explorer $42/user/month. Viewer $15/user/month. AI features included in standard subscriptions. 14-day trial.

Power BI Copilot is a direct competitor at lower price points for Microsoft-centric organisations. Looker provides Google-native BI with Gemini AI. Qlik provides AI-enhanced analytics as a strong alternative.

SOC 2 Type II. ISO 27001. GDPR compliant. FedRAMP authorised. HIPAA eligible. Salesforce enterprise security.
Data processed under Salesforce/Tableau enterprise data handling agreements. Customer data not used for AI model training.
Editorial Verdict
Tableau AI is most valuable for organisations already invested in Tableau who want AI-enhanced analytics without adopting additional tools. New BI platform evaluators should compare Tableau, Power BI, and Looker comprehensively.
